Table 3: Hot Gas Bypass Valve Sizing Chart
Direct Acting Discharge Bypass Valve Capacities (Tons)
Capacities based on discharge temperatures 50°F above is entropic compression, 25°F superheat at the compressor, 10°F sub-cooling, and includes both the hot
gas bypassed and liquid refrigerant for desuperheating, regardless of whether the liquid is fed through the system thermostatic expansion valves or an auxiliary
desuperheating thermostatic expansion valve.
